مستخلص: With the present day accepted high strength materials and the construction techniques that have been moving on the road to "stiffness" and "lightness," high rise structures have evolved based on structural concepts. Data from the past indicates that there is a rise in the demand for earthquake-resistant buildings. As a result, the seismic effect must be considered during the design and analysis of structures. Tall buildings can be equipped with a number of lateral load resistance systems, including moment resisting frames, shear wall systems, bracing systems, space trusses, tubular structures, and others. The most cutting-edge structural system for tall skyscraper design is called Diagrid. This document presents a comparison of the diagrid system, rigid frame system, and shear wall system. Two distinct plan configurations, namely an octagon and a square, have been modelled and examined for an 18-story diagrid building, a rigid frame building, and a building with shear wall systems. Six structures in total are modelized and examined to check with the system resists lateral loads the best. On ETABS, modelling and analysis have been done. The dynamic analysis is excecuted utilising the Response Spectrum Technique. According to Indian requirements, every loading and inspection is offered. For the investigation, factors including base shear, time period along with storey displacement, and storey drift are taken into account [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
